Mischief is the name of a frisky circus pony in this British kiddie-matinee fodder. When Mischief inadvertently throws young Adrienne Byrne, the horse is slated to be destroyed. A happy ending ensues after Mischief helps Paul Fraser rescue Adrienne from a grisly fate. The story is fairly cut-and-dried, but children who love ponies won't complain. At 57 minutes, Mischief is just long enough to avoid wearing out its welcome.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
